Introduction
The OnCell 5004/5104-HSPA series are high-performance industrial grade cellular routers that allow up to 4 Ethernet-based devices to simultaneously use a single cellular data account for primary or backup network connectivity to remote sites and devices. Both products provide the functionality of a cellular router, firewall, and switch in one device, and to ensure zero data loss and on-demand cellular communication, the OnCell 5004/5104-HSPA are integrated with the GuaranLink function. The difference between the OnCell 5004-HSPA and OnCell 5104-HSPA is that the OnCell 5104-HSPA comes with a built-in relay output that can be configured to indicate the priority of events when notifying or warning engineers in the field, and the two digital inputs allow you to connect basic I/O devices, such as sensors, to the cellular network. The OnCell 5004-HSPA can be placed on a desktop or wall-mounted, whereas the OnCell 5104-HSPA has an IA design and can be attached to a DIN-rail. Both products use 12 to 48 VDC power inputs with a screw-on design for greater reliability, and the Ethernet ports come with 1.5 KV magnetic isolation protection to keep your system safe from unexpected electrical discharges.

| • Cellular Interface | |
| Standards | GSM/GPRS/EDGE/UMTS/HSPA |
| Band Options | • Five-band UMTS/HSPA 800/850/AWS/1900/2100 MHz • Quad-band GSM/GPRS/EDGE 850/900/1800/1900 MHz |
| HSPA Data Rate | 14.4 Mbps DL, 5.76 Mbps UL |
| EDGE Multi-slot Class | Class 12 |
| EDGE Data Rate | 237 kbps DL, 237 kbps UL |
| EDGE Terminal Device Class | Class B |
| GPRS Multi-slot Class | Class 12 |
| GPRS Data Rate | 85.6 kbps DL, 85.6 kbps UL |
| GPRS Terminal Device Class | Class B |
| GPRS Coding Schemes | CS1 to CS4 |
| Tx Power | UMTS/HSPA: 0.25 W EDGE900: 0.5 W EDGE1800: 0.4 W GSM1800: 1 W GSM900: 2 W |
